Definitions
- a. Made of wire; like wire; drawn out like wire.
- a. Capable of endurance; tough; sinewy; as, a wiry frame or constitution.
- adj. lean and sinewy
- adj. of or relating to wire
- adj. of hair that resembles wire in stiffness
- 1. Made of wire; like wire; drawn out like wire. 2. Capable of endurance; tough; sinewy; as, a wiry frame or constitution. "A little wiry sergeant of meek demeanor and strong sense." Dickens. He bore his age well, and seemed to retain a wiry vigor and alertness. Hawthorne.
